These guys have been touring longer than the real Queen did with Freddie and they continue to play to sell out venues in a few different countries so you know they are doing something right. You will see 5 guys working their butts off every night and never having less than 100% energy. Do NOT listen to the negative reviews. A few things to mention because those complaints are from people who obviously do NOT know Queen... *During Bohemian Rhapsody, they leave the stage during the operatic section and a few complained about this. If you ever saw the real Queen you would know that this is how THEY did it. They never performed that part live. *The complaints about Gary not hitting all of the notes and taking songs down an octave. Have you EVER seen a Queen live show? Freddie NEVER sounded like he did in the studio and there were MANY shows when he couldn't hit the notes (Roger carried him a lot) and he had to take songs down an octave because his voice was trashed (because we know that Freddie didn't really take care of his voice as he should have) People need to stop walking in with the expectations of seeing Freddie. Just like they complain about Adam Lambert with the real Queen. Freddie is gone. These guys are not him and never claim to be. They are paying tribute to the best frontman we have ever seen. One Night of Queen does an incredible job at recreating the energy of a live Queen show. Honestly I think that Gary has more energy than Adam Lambert, having seen both live numerous times.
